Concrete Porch Resurfacing in Des Moines, IA
Concrete porch resurfacing involves revitalizing and updating existing porch surfaces to improve appearance, durability, and safety. This service typically covers projects where the existing concrete is cracked, stained, or worn, offering options such as applying decorative overlays, stains, or textured finishes to enhance curb appeal. Homeowners often request this service to achieve a fresh, modern look without the expense of complete replacement, or to repair minor damage that affects the porch’s functionality and aesthetic.
Before requesting concrete porch resurfacing, property owners usually want to understand the condition of the existing concrete and the types of finishes available. It’s important to consider the overall style of the home, the desired level of maintenance, and how the resurfaced porch will complement other outdoor features. Proper surface preparation is essential for lasting results, and understanding the expected durability and care requirements can help homeowners make informed decisions about their porch upgrade.

Concrete Porch Resurfacing Questions
What is concrete porch resurfacing? It involves applying a new finish or overlay to improve the appearance and durability of an existing concrete porch.
What types of finishes are available? Options include stamped patterns, decorative coatings, and textured overlays to match various styles.
Can resurfacing repair cracks and damage? Yes, surface repairs are typically part of the process to create a smooth, even finish.
Is resurfacing suitable for all concrete porches? Resurfacing works best on stable, properly prepared concrete surfaces that are free of major structural issues.
